short for Nilufar - A Persian name for a girl. Persian word for a flower known as "Morning Glory"(purple/blue flower that grows as a vine, the flower opens in the morning and closes in the evening). Artist that releases her O.C.D. in her art. Descendant of a king.
what a beautiful Nilu.
by Medi Hashimoto February 04, 2010